A dark stone faerie home with a heavily mossed branch stretching far out to one side

Mossreach Faerie House is built from the mountain's darker grey-green stone, softened here with a ring of gentle lilac glass around both windows and the door. What sets this house apart is its branch — thickly covered in soft green moss from base to tip, it stretches out from the upper wall further than most, heavy and full, as though the moss itself had grown so contentedly there that the branch could barely hold its own weight. More moss climbs generously up both side walls, giving the whole house a settled, deeply established feel.

This is a house that seems to have been standing a very long time — belonging to a faerie who lets moss have its way entirely, whose home has become so thoroughly part of the woodland around it that it's hard to say where one ends and the other begins.

Handcrafted from deep grey-green stones gathered on Mangerton Mountain in County Kerry, the walls carry the mountain's more elemental character, softened by lilac glass and generous natural moss growth. The gentle lilac gem trim, heavily mossed reaching branch, and thick moss-covered walls give Mossreach Faerie House its wonderfully ancient, woodland-established character.

Sealed for outdoor display, Mossreach Faerie House is ready for the oldest, mossiest corner of the garden — beneath established trees, against old stone, or anywhere time has already begun to soften the edges.
